About Zehan
Zehan, meaning "consciousness" in Tigrigna, is rooted in the belief that awareness, when organized into systems, can lead to meaningful and lasting change.
Our Mission
- To empower the youth in Tigray with practical skills to bring about actionable solutions, enabling them to become key contributors in creating a strong, peaceful, and self-confident society.
- To support the war-affected segments of society—specifically the youth, women, and displaced individuals—by raising awareness and engaging in supportive work activities.
- Our long-term goal is to continuously foster a conscious, dedicated, and united young generation.
- Our organization is youth-led, impartial, independent, and a non-profit association working with care and dedication.
Our Story
How can we move from individual support to structured systems that consistently reach young people who need them most?
This was the question a group of friends came together to answer last summer. We wanted build something that responds to the harsh realities young people in Tigray were facing. And with that Zehan was born. A youth-led center for youth development.
One of our initial ideas was to support internally displaced children through a tutoring initiative. While we were not able to fully implement it, the process taught us important lessons about the complexity of working in such contexts. It made us realize that real impact requires structured planning, adaptability, and a grounded understanding of the challenges communities face.
